Saturn is the sixth planet from the sun. Saturn is a huge ball of gas that includes a small solid core. It's ring is made up of dust and icy chunks.
Saturn's atmosphere is very dense and has an average temperature of
-125 degrees celsius. It is tilted on a 26.7 degree axial, it is about 1,427 million kilometres away from the sun.
Saturn has 53 moons and the main one is Titan. Saturn rotates 9.66km per second.
